Output 5aec8f0f8623b213959e27c42f69d41d6c8cf7ff755185694d5c8f49df11815a:0

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af252bc6184eba18b74ed4270b31d1ee33b130b0 OP_EQUAL
address
3Hf6hoLv2kXB2rhUNRBWWpJNKNgps9cJef
transaction
5aec8f0f8623b213959e27c42f69d41d6c8cf7ff755185694d5c8f49df11815a
spent
true